Cleyr
Cleyr, known internally as Montclair and also known as the Cleyran Marches, is the kingdom of the Cleyran ratfolk and consists of a united confederation of principalities who swear allegiance to the Marquess of Montclair who rules as king. The current Marquess of Montclair and king of Cleyr is Louis Rochelle Legrande de Beaumont.
History
Cleyr is a relatively recent kingdom, founded about 300 years ago by a group of ratfolk heroes and the armies they gathered to themselves. They drove out dragons and elves and made a home for their kind in the Wintermarches.

Provinces
The four major provinces of Cleyr are Montclair, Bernicia, Deira, and the Northern Provinces
Montclair
Montclair is the westernmost province of the Cleyran Marches and constitutes the original settlement of the Cleyran Army plus newer western holdings. The Army was lead by Richard Legrande, who at the time did not use the title of king, but is retroactively considered the first King of Montclair, Garlaunde Deschamps, Theophania Arondelle, and a few other prominent leaders in their generation and the subsequent generation. The name refers to the picturesque snowcapped mountain around which the initial fortified cities were built. The mountain could be seen for many miles and was called by various names by the Cleyrans including Montclair, Beaumont, Serein, Le Mont Solitaire and other similar names. The mountain is an isolated cluster of three peaks around which several river basins and is nearby a major tributary of the primary river of the Cleyr Marches. It was known to the former elven kingdoms of Bernicia and Deira but was not considered significant as they did not care to extend power that far west until they were challenged by the newly arrived Cleyrans which settled in the no-man's land between Bernicia and the northernmost extents of Lugal which were only weakly claimed by either polity.
Bernicia
Bernicia is geographically the central province of Cleyr, but not the center of political power. It consists of the former high elven kingdom of Bernicia and successful campaigns by the ruling Deschamps family in eastward expansion. It has the advantage of being insulated from most of the major geopolitical threats against its existence and this has encouraged a considerable separatist sentiment among the nobility of Bernicia. It is bordered by Montclair on the west, Deira to the south, the Northern Provinces to the north, and wilderness tribes of Snow Elves to the east. The direct conflicts that Bernicia faces are with these snow elves. All the provinces of Cleyr are in a mutual defense agreement and so it is not at all uncommon for troops from Montclair to defend Bernicia against attacks from Snow Elves and Bernician troops to help policing the Lugalin lands that Montclair claims. Both Bernicia and Montclair send troops to the Northern Provinces and to Deira.
Notable settlements in Bernicia include Anseau, Bèrnichéplas, Vîdeschamps

Deira
Also known as Cleyran Deira to distinguish it from the elven rump state of the same name is the southeastern province.
Deira shares a border state and is at war with the residue of the Kingdom of Deira, which is fiercely defended by high elf allies as a necessary buffer state preventing the southward expansion of the Cleyrans into territories of other high elven kingdoms. This war has been going on for as long as any portion of Deira has been controlled by the Cleyrans, which is nearly the entire history of Cleyr.
Notable settlements in Deira include Deira, Trèfle, Blonde, Cimerlanric,Cerniu, Cerros, Cercloudina the historical capitol of Deira and the recently captured former capitol of Elven Deira, Finavondine.
